Thirty years ago in Oklahoma City, on April 19, 1995, an act of terrorism took lives and irreparably changed many others. People responded in its aftermath with resilience, compassion, and a commitment to supporting one another. From this response came the Oklahoma Standard—a tradition of service, respect, and everyday kindness.
